Country: Greece
Address: 2, Artemissiou Str. &Fleming Sqr. Glyfada
Website: http://epctank.com
On site since: May 5, 2025
Greece
10, Diadochou Pavlou str.
Greece
1 Ygias & Akti Themistokleous, 185 36 Piraeus, Greece
Greece
107, Vouliagmenis Ave., 166 74 Glyfada. Athens, Greece